    Well, Thanks for the response you two! Because of the both of you, I did call my endocrinologist and he immediately told me to GET IN HERE (his office) for blood work. I wasnt just hypo, I was severely hypo and almost myxedema (swelling of face, hands, and feet are a give away). So thank you both for saying to have blood work done. He had some panels done and the regular ones (panels were STAT blood work). I am now being treated and well, have a more thorough checkup on Friday to make sure no more damage was done as the swelling is a sign of tissue damage (due to the, go figure, autoimmune disease).

    Listen to your bodies everyone. If you just dont feel right, go to your endo and pursue it until he/she listens. I could’ve been in the hospital if I hadn’t listen to the responses here or my instinct.
